The 6LR61 battery is the most standard and widely used 9V square alkaline primary battery in the consumer and industrial electronics industry. It can be seen in household safety detectors, portable testing instruments, wireless audio devices and smart peripheral equipment. Although it is a common power accessory, improper selection and irregular operation often lead to shortened device life, battery leakage and even potential safety hazards. 6LR61 is an IEC-standard non-rechargeable alkaline battery with a standard open-circuit voltage of 9V. Its model code represents complete product attribute information:
The number “6” means six independent 1.5V cylindrical cells connected in series inside the battery; the letter “L” stands for alkaline electrolyte system; “R” indicates the internal cell is round-shaped; “61” is the unified size code for traditional 9V block batteries. This mature structural design enables the 6LR61 to achieve standard high voltage output in a compact square shell.
Standard parameters are the basis for judging battery applicability. The universal specifications of qualified 6LR61 alkaline batteries are as follows:
Nominal Voltage: 9V DC
Typical Capacity: 500–600mAh (under standard discharge conditions)
External Dimension: 48.5mm × 26.5mm × 17.5mm
Shelf Life: 3–5 years under normal room temperature and dry environment
Annual Self-discharge Rate: Less than 3%
Working Temperature Range: -20℃ to 60℃
Compared with the traditional carbon-zinc 6F22 9V battery, 6LR61 alkaline battery features higher energy density, more stable voltage output, longer standby time and stronger anti-attenuation ability, which is the mainstream upgraded version of 9V batteries on the market.
6LR61 alkaline batteries are suitable for most low and medium current 9V electronic devices, covering household, commercial and industrial fields:
Household safety equipment: Smoke detectors, carbon monoxide alarms, gas sensors
Testing and measuring tools: Digital multimeters, portable environmental detectors, industrial thermometers
Audio and communication equipment: Wireless microphones, portable radios, walkie-talkies
Smart electronic devices: Electronic musical instruments, intelligent remote controls, professional toys
6LR61 is a disposable primary battery with fixed chemical characteristics. Standardized use can effectively avoid leakage, equipment damage and safety accidents. The following precautions must be strictly followed during installation, use and storage.
The chemical reaction of 6LR61 alkaline battery is irreversible. Any manual charging behavior will break the internal chemical balance, cause excessive gas accumulation inside the sealed shell, and further lead to battery bulging, liquid leakage, high temperature heating, and even explosion in severe cases. Users must never use any charger to charge non-rechargeable 6LR61 batteries.
Short circuit is one of the most common causes of battery damage. Do not contact the positive and negative terminals of the battery with metal conductors such as keys, wires and coin. Short circuit will produce instantaneous high current and high temperature, burn the internal structure of the battery, and may trigger fire risks. In addition, do not place loose 9V batteries together with metal accessories to prevent accidental short circuit.
Do not mix new and old 6LR61 batteries, nor mix alkaline batteries with carbon-zinc batteries or rechargeable nickel-metal hydride batteries. Different batteries have inconsistent internal resistance and residual power. Mixed use will cause unbalanced discharge, resulting in over-discharge of old or low-performance batteries, which greatly increases the probability of electrolyte leakage and equipment circuit damage.
Unused 6LR61 batteries should be stored in a cool, dry and ventilated environment, avoiding long-term exposure to high temperature, humidity and direct sunlight. High temperature will accelerate self-discharge and aging of the battery, while humid environment will cause oxidation of the battery contact points and poor conductivity. Do not store batteries in damp places such as bathrooms and basements for a long time.
When installing the battery, confirm the positive and negative polarity marks of the equipment battery slot to avoid reverse installation. Long-term use will cause oxidation and dust accumulation on the battery contact pieces. Regular cleaning is required to ensure good contact, prevent virtual power failure and unstable operation of the equipment.
After the battery power is exhausted, do not discard it randomly. Waste alkaline batteries contain trace chemical components. It is necessary to classify and recycle them in accordance with local environmental protection regulations to avoid soil and water pollution. Centralized recycling is especially recommended for industrial batch used batteries.
When purchasing 6LR61 batteries, prioritize regular brand products with complete certification. Inferior counterfeit batteries have insufficient capacity, unstable voltage and poor sealing performance, which are prone to leakage and failure. For long-term standby devices such as smoke alarms, high-quality low self-discharge 6LR61 alkaline batteries should be selected to ensure long-term stable power supply.
If the battery is not used for a long time after being installed in the equipment, it is recommended to take out the battery properly to prevent the battery from aging and leaking and corroding the equipment circuit.
